Abstract

Statement of Problem: Bitewing radiography is a suitable clinical technique for the diagnosis of interproximal caries. Many researches performed in this field have shown that direct digital radiography and conventional radiography films in dentistry are similar in detecting inter-proximal caries.Purpose: To compare the effects of image processing mode of colorize on the efficacy of the detection of interproximal carious lesions viewed in direct digital radiography.Methods and Material: A total of 102 proximal surfaces of the extracted human premolar teeth on direct digital images with and without application of pseudocolor filter were evaluated by three observers. The teeth were sectioned and viewed microscopically to determine the gold standard. The kappa value agreement ratio was calculated.Results: Sensitivity and specificity values in normal digital images were found to be 66.7% and 60% and for colorized images 80.5% and 50%, respectively. However, there was no statistically significant difference between the two types of images (p = 0.12).Conclusion: In this study, application of pseudocolor software failed to result in statistically significant differences between normal and colorized digital images.Key word: Pseudocolor, Radiography dental digital, Dental caries
